The Device Simulator for Windows SideShow, developed by Microsoft, is a software tool that allows developers to simulate the functionality and behavior of Windows SideShow devices. It provides developers with an easy way to test and debug their applications without the need for actual physical hardware.

Using the Device Simulator, developers can create SideShow gadgets and see how they function in a simulated environment. The tool provides a range of features to help developers create, configure, and test their gadgets. It supports both USB and Bluetooth connections between the simulated device and the computer running the simulator.

The Device Simulator allows developers to create a virtual device, configure various settings such as display size and orientation, and install any drivers or other software required for the gadget to function properly. Developers can then use the simulator to test their gadgets using realistic scenarios, such as displaying images, text, or media files.

The simulator also includes some sample gadgets that developers can use as references or build upon. The included gadgets demonstrate various features that can be implemented, such as displaying weather information, media control, email notifications, and more.

What is the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ow?

The Device Simulator for Windows SideShow is a tool provided by Microsoft that allows developers to simulate a Windows SideShow device on their computer.

What is Windows SideShow?

Windows SideShow is a technology developed by Microsoft that enables data and alerts to be displayed on auxiliary displays, such as secondary screens, remote controls, or other external devices.

Why would I want to use the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ow?

The Device Simulator allows developers to test and debug their Windows SideShow applications without the need for an actual physical device.

What are the system requirements for the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ow?

The Device Simulator requires Windows Vista or later, along with the .NET Framework version 2.0 or higher.

How can I install the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ow?

The Device Simulator can be installed by downloading and running the setup package provided by Microsoft.

Can I develop custom Windows SideShow devices using the Device Simulator?

No, the Device Simulator is intended for testing and debugging purposes only, and does not support developing custom devices.

Does the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ow support all features of actual devices?

While the Device Simulator aims to replicate most of the functionality of actual devices, there may be some differences and limitations.

Can I simulate multiple devices simultaneously using the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ow?

Yes, you can simulate multiple devices at the same time by launching multiple instances of the Device Simulator.

Where can I find documentation and resources for developing Windows SideShow applications?

Microsoft provides documentation and resources on their official Windows SideShow website, as well as through their developer network.

Is the Device Simulator for Windows SideShow a replacement for testing on physical devices?

No, while the Device Simulator provides a convenient way to test and debug applications, it is still recommended to perform real-world testing on physical devices to ensure proper functionality.
